Description
Summary:Rayleigh and Love wave group, and phase velocity dispersion has been determined for two profiles crossing the interior of Greenland. It was found that the dispersion is similar on the two profiles. The observed dispersion is only a little different from the Canadian Shield dispersion. The observations have been compared with theoretical model dispersion curves. A model G-62 has been developed for the Greenlandic Shield. It is similar to the model for the Canadian Shield. The depth to the Mohorovičić discontinuity appears to be a little greater than in Canada.
